Understanding Brazilian and Bikini Waxing Kits
Brazilian and bikini waxing kits are created to remove hair from the bikini space, with Brazilian waxing typically involving the complete removal of hair from the front and back. Bikini waxing, however, focuses on the area outside of an ordinary bikini line. These kits are available numerous formats, with different types of wax, tools, and skin-care products included.
Most kits include either hard wax or soft wax. Hard wax is ideal for sensitive areas, as it adheres to the hair relatively than the skin, reducing discomfort. Soft wax requires strips for removal and might be more efficient for finer hair but could cause more irritation if not used carefully.
Key Elements of a Quality Waxing Kit
When selecting a Brazilian or bikini waxing kit, there are several elements to look for:
High-quality wax: The wax ought to melt evenly and apply smoothly. Hard wax is generally recommended for beginners.
Pre-wax cleanser: Helps remove oils and put together the skin.
After-wax soothing lotion: Reduces redness and calms the skin.
Applicators: Spatulas of assorted sizes ensure precise application in delicate areas.
Detailed directions: Clear steering can assist you achieve professional results.
Some advanced kits also embrace a wax warmer, which provides better control over the wax temperature. Maintaining the proper temperature is essential to avoid burns or ineffective waxing.
Find out how to Prepare for At-Home Brazilian or Bikini Waxing
Preparation is essential for a profitable waxing session. Listed here are just a few tips to follow:
Hair size: Hair ought to be a couple of quarter-inch long for optimum results. If it’s too short, the wax may not grip the hair; too long, and waxing will be more painful.
Exfoliate: Gently exfoliating the area 24 hours earlier than waxing helps remove dead skin cells, stopping ingrown hairs.
Clean and dry skin: Ensure the area is clean and free from lotions or oils.
Pain management: Some individuals take an over-the-counter pain reliever about 30 minutes earlier than waxing to ease discomfort.
Waxing Process: Step by Step
Using an at-home kit requires persistence and practice. Observe these steps for the best outcome:
Heat the wax according to the instructions, making certain it reaches the proper consistency.
Test the temperature on a small patch of skin to keep away from burns.
Apply the wax in the direction of hair growth, working in small sections.
Enable the wax to cool slightly if utilizing hard wax, or place a strip over soft wax.
Remove the wax quickly within the opposite direction of hair growth, holding the skin taut.
Apply the after-wax lotion to soothe the area.
Suggestions for Success
Work in small sections: The bikini area is sensitive, and smaller sections permit for higher control and less pain.
Keep constant: Common waxing can lead to finer, less painful hair regrowth over time.
Be gentle: Keep away from vigorous activity or tight clothing for twenty-four hours after waxing to forestall irritation.
Potential Risks and Learn how to Keep away from Them
While at-home waxing may be efficient, there are risks to be aware of:
Skin irritation: Redness and sensitivity are common. Using a chilled lotion helps.
Burns: Always test wax temperature earlier than application.
Ingrown hairs: Common exfoliation and moisturizing assist forestall this issue.
When you have sensitive skin or are unsure about the process, starting with a professional waxing session earlier than making an attempt it at home is an effective idea.
